> I have a Visual basic 6.0 program that uses ADO to access the
> HP3000 using ODBCLink/SE version 5.56.1200. It retrieves records
> but I cannot update/delete/add records to the database. I have
> added the user to the DBE and set it up for mode 1. When I use
> the recordset.supports() function in VB UPDATE, DELETE, ADDNEW
> and UPDATEBATCH all return as false.
>
> Is there something special that needs to be done to allow
> updates to Image/SQL through the ODBCLink/SE driver?
>
You are most likely going throuh the Jet engine (probably 3.5 or
3.51) and this requires that the row have a unique index to permit
updates. There is a way to fake out VB to make it believe that
this is the case. I will try and locate a code example for you
later this morning.
